History
Established in 2008.
Completing a fellowship in male reproductive medicine and microsurgery, Dr. Turek was recruited to the faculty of the University of California San Francisco (UCSF), one of the nation’s top ten hospitals. While there, Dr. Turek served with distinction, performing incisive and widely praised research, publishing hundreds of papers and lecturing around the world. In time, he was awarded membership in the prestigious Academy of Medical Educators and became a full professor, with an Endowed Chair in Urology. Yet despite the international acclaim and the chance to mentor the next generation of physicians, Dr. Turek realized that what he most enjoyed is caring for patients with reproductive health problems. As Dr. Turek explains, «I’ve always believed in scientific research because it generates medical knowledge, but what matters most to me is how that translates into good, old-fashioned wisdom for patient care.» That simple but deeply felt insight gave birth to The Turek Clinic.

Male reproductive health expert Dr. Paul Turek is founder of The Turek Clinic, a leading health care resource for men worldwide. Dr. Turek is a recent recipient of a prestigious National Institutes of Health (NIH) grant for research designed to help infertile men become fathers. A former Professor and Endowed Chair at the University of California San Francisco, Dr. Turek has pioneered innovative techniques for treating male infertility, including Testicular Mapping.
